LYNCHBURG, Va. – Two Lancer seniors, outfielder
Sammy Miller and right-handed pitcher
Zach Potojecki, received All-Big South postseason honors, announced by the conference office Tuesday morning.
Miller received All-Big South Honorable Mention accolades, while Potojecki was named to the academic team for the second time in his career. The all-conference award is the first all-conference award for Miller and the second for Potojecki. The Lancers have placed a player on the postseason all-conference teams all six seasons since joining the Big South.
Miller, a native of Shrewsbury, Pa., is a four-year starter at Longwood and has been atop the order as the lead-off hitter and center fielder each of the last two years for the Lancers. Miller has led Longwood in on-base percentage and stolen bases each of the last two seasons as the sparkplug for the offense.
In 2018 Miller has started every game in center and as the lead-off man is reaching base at a .418 clip, the highest on-base percentage of his career. Miller finished the regular season fourth in the Big South with 20 stolen bases, leading a Lancer charge that paced the conference in steals as a team. Miller is also seventh in the Big South and one shy of his career high with 39 walks drawn as the senior has improved upon his career .398 on-base percentage.
Miller has been Longwood's lead-off man for the better part of the last three years and is as steady as they come in the outfield with a perfect 1.000 fielding percentage in 99 chances and a team-high five outfield assists.
Potojecki, a Business Administration Major with a Concentration in Finance, finished 2018 with a 3.52 GPA to earn the nod on the Big South All-Academic team for a second consecutive season. The senior pitcher, who earned his degree this past Saturday, was awarded the Bob McCloskey Insurance Big South Graduate Fellowship, designated for one male and female student-athlete at a Big South institution who plans on continuing their studies after their senior season. With the fellowship comes a $2,000 grant for Potojecki to graduate school. Potojecki is the fifth Lancer to earn the fellowship since Longwood joined the conference before the 2012-2013 school year.
A native of Danville, Va., Potojecki finished the year as a part of the weekend rotation, capping off his season with 4.0 innings of work against Gardner-Webb Sunday. Potojecki struck out 22 batters in 20.0 innings of work in 2018 and enters the postseason with 131 career strikeouts in 116.2 career innings pitched.
Miller and Potojecki are the 15th and 16th players to receive all-conference honors, joining current teammate
Michael Catlin as a part of that list, as Catlin was a 2016 all-academic team member.
Miller has also picked up Big South All-Tournament Team honors, earning the distinction in 2016. As a part of Longwood's run to the conference tournament semifinal Miller hit .467 (7-for-15) in the 2016 championship with six RBI, two runs scored, and was a perfect 2-for-2 in stolen bases.
